Regional Focus

Bellevue and the Work Visa Landscape

The Bellevue-Redmond tech corridor is one of the highest-concentration work visa markets in the United States. Approximately 43% of Bellevue's population is foreign-born, and major employers in cloud computing, AI, enterprise software, and other technology sectors sponsor thousands of work visas annually, creating a dynamic and competitive immigration landscape.

H-1B Visa Program

The H-1B is the primary pathway for U.S. employers to sponsor foreign professionals in specialty occupations. Learn about eligibility requirements, cap registration, and the petition process for Bellevue-area tech roles.

TN Visa (USMCA)

Canadian and Mexican professionals may qualify for TN status under the USMCA trade agreement. We guide eligible professionals through documentation requirements and employer coordination for TN classification.

O-1 Extraordinary Ability

The O-1 visa is available to individuals with extraordinary ability or achievement in their field. We help build compelling petitions that demonstrate sustained national or international recognition.

L-1 Intracompany Transfer

The L-1 visa enables multinational companies to transfer managers, executives, and specialized knowledge employees to U.S. offices. We advise on both L-1A and L-1B classification strategies.

PERM Labor Certification

PERM is the first step in most employer-sponsored green card processes, requiring a test of the U.S. labor market. We manage prevailing wage determinations, recruitment, and audit-ready filings.

Employment Green Cards

EB-1, EB-2, and EB-3 green cards provide permanent residency pathways for professionals and their families. We guide both employers and employees through the multi-step sponsorship process.
